Amazon is driven by being “the world’s most customer centric company." In the Compliance Tech. organization, we own ensuring that all products at Amazon are 100% compliant with all legal, trade, product safety, environmental and food safety requirements. We’re obsessed with the safety of all our customers and workers, creating a world-class experience for our millions of vendors and sellers world-wide, and inventing the best business and regulatory models for safe and sustainable chains in our industries.

As a Sr. Software Engineer you will work with your manager and team of highly skilled software, data, and test engineers to invent, design, build and manage highly scalable distributed systems that provide availability, scalability and latency guarantees. You will work with your internal customers to balance customer requirements with team requirements and help your team and business evolve. Engineers in the team have opportunities to collaborate with teams working on machine learning models and large data sets. You will be using the latest AWS and industry technologies to deliver a one-stop authoritative compliance ecosystem for Amazon, keeping our customers safe and products compliant, building the software creating the world’s most authoritative data set on everything companies and customers need to know related to the safety and compliance of products and chains.

Each and every person buying, selling, or handling Amazon products will be your customer.

To succeed in this role, you must be passionate about delivering high-quality software designs, code and components. You must be creative in solving hard problems and unafraid to think out-of-the-box.

If you’d like to make a real-world difference by working hard, having fun, and making history, this is the team for you!

Key Responsibilities:
· Design and develop critical components of world class, scalable distributed systems.
· Interface with our internal customers and technical leadership to inform and understand requirements and priorities.
· Take on hard, ambiguous problems and articulate solutions that will to serve the broader Amazon.
· Help develop long-term technical strategies in the product space.


BASIC QUALIFICATIONS

· Master's Degree in Computer Science or related degree
· 5+ years of experience in software development
· Experience around how high-performance, highly-available, highly scalable and large distributed systems works
· Knowledge of system design principles
· Computer Science fundamentals in data structures, algorithm design, problem solving, and complexity analysis
· Proficiency in Java, C#, Scala, or other similar programming languages


PREFERRED QUALIFICATIONS

· Knowledge of professional software engineering practices & best practices for the full software development life cycle, including coding standards, code reviews, source control management, build processes, testing, and operations
· Ability to take a project from scoping requirements through actual launch of the project
· Experience in communicating with users, other technical teams, and management to collect requirements, describe software product features, and technical designs.
· Experience influencing software engineering best practices within your team
· Strong problem solving, communication, presentation and interpersonal skills.
· Ability to work well with people and be both highly motivated and motivating.
· Hands-on expertise in disparate technologies, typically ranging from front-end user interfaces through to back-end systems and all points in between
· Expertise in one or more AWS products/services

Amazon is committed to a diverse and inclusive workplace. Amazon is an equal opportunity employer and does not discriminate on the basis of race, national origin, gender, gender identity, sexual orientation, protected veteran status, disability, age, or other legally protected status. For individuals with disabilities who would like to request an accommodation, please visit https://www.amazon.jobs/en/disability/us.

Últimas ofertas de Law Enforcement